Lenore Wilkas wasn’t sure whether she should take a summer vacation.

But then the number of COVID-19 cases started to drop. And she got her vaccination. And then, she found some availability for her Marriott timeshare on Kauai. So she booked flights for early September.

“I feel safe going,” says Wilkas, a real estate agent from Vista, California.

What will it take for you to take a summer vacation? Fewer COVID-19 cases? Cheap accommodations? A vaccination? It all depends.

new poll by travel insurance firm World Nomads suggests 66% of Americans are planning a summer trip. Of those, about one-third have already made reservations.
